A 8.0x10^-2-kg ice cube at 0.0 C is dropped into a Styrofoam cup holding 0.35 kg of water at 11 C. Find the final temperature of the system. Find the amount of ice (if any) remaining. Find the initial temperature of the water that would be enough to just barely melt all of the ice.
